  • 11.1 a1c — Not sure where to turn.
    I like https://realplans.com/ it is a pay service, but you can start with a base diet there is a low carb one, and then add and subtract specific foods you like or don't like or want to avoid. From there it will generate a meal plan for you with a shopping list. It also has an app which works well for the shopping list. I would just do 4 servings dinner recipes and have extra for my wife and I for lunch the next day. Source: about 2 years ago
